How much do senior php codeigniter j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for senior php codeigniter in the United States is $124,327.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$105,500.00 and $138,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Senior PHP CodeIgniter Develop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ior PHP CodeIgniter Developer, you need deep expertise in PHP programming, experience with the CodeIgniter framework, and a solid understanding of web development fundamentals, usually backed by a degree in computer science or related field.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, RESTful API integration, and database management (MySQL) is essential, along with experience using debugging and deployment tools. Strong problem-solving abilities, communication skills, and the capability to mentor junior developers are valuable soft skills in this role. These skills ensure effective, scalable solutions, smooth team collaboration, and the delivery of reliable applications.

What are typical challenges faced by Senior PHP CodeIgniter developers when working on large-scale applications?

Senior PHP CodeIgniter developers working on large-scale applications often encounter challenges such as maintaining clean and scalable codebases, optimizing performance for high-traffic environments, and ensuring robust security practices. Collaboration with front-end teams and other back-end developers is common, particularly when integrating new features or refactoring legacy code. Additionally, staying updated with best practices and framework updates is essential for long-term project success and minimizing technical debt.

What are Senior PHP CodeIgniter developers?

Senior PHP CodeIgniter developers are experienced software engineers who specialize in building and maintaining web applications using the PHP programming language and the CodeIgniter framework. They are responsible for designing, developing, and optimizing scalable solutions, often leading projects or mentoring junior developers. Their expertise includes advanced knowledge of PHP, CodeIgniter best practices, database design, and application security. Additionally, they collaborate with cross-functional teams to ensure high-quality, maintainable code and efficient project delivery.

Job description

Department: IT AS App Dev & Ops
Salary/Grade: ITS/78
Target hiring range for this position will be between $72,339-$77,312 per year. Offered salary will be determined by the applicant's education, experience, knowledge, skills and abilities, as well as internal equity and alignment with market data.
Job Summary:
Efficiently develops, tests, deploys, and debugs new software or enhancements to existing software with occasional assistance. Often works collaboratively but may coordinate some low-complexity projects independently. Works directly with analysts and senior team members to design and implement technical solutions ensuring that business needs and requirements are met. Performs basic system integration tasks. Provides estimation for assigned tasks.
Please note: Under our current hybrid work model, a minimum of two in-office days with the team are expected per week, subject to change.
Specific Responsibilities:
Strategic Planning
  • Collaborates with analysts and users to develop workflows and features.
  • Assists in all stages of the project, starting from the initial planning stages.
Administration
  • Responds to inquiries and adheres to Northwestern's ITSM.
  • Creates and maintains software, process, and support documentation.
  • Communicates, diagnoses, and resolves database and software performance issues.
Development
  • Executes all phases of the SDLC with occasional guidance.
  • Works with business analysts and stakeholders to determine and document requirements.
  • Designs databases and data structures.
  • Develops applications according to specifications from analysts and senior developers to support business requirements.
  • Completes tier 3 troubleshooting.
  • Prioritizes assigned tasks.
  • Escalates issues with vendors as appropriate.
Miscellaneous
Performs other duties as assigned.
Minimum Qualifications:
  • Successful completion of a full 4-year course of study in an accredited college or university leading to a bachelor's or higher degree in a major such as computer science, information technology, or related; OR appropriate combination of education and experience.
